Change Manager I
Western Governors University is committed to expanding access to higher education through innovative online programs. The Change Manager will focus on ensuring successful project outcomes by implementing change management strategies that promote employee adoption and minimize resistance.

Responsibilities
Apply a structured change management methodology and lead change management activities as defined within the Prosci ADKAR change management framework
Assess the change impacts of assigned projects or transformation initiatives
Complete change management assessments and present action plans to executive sponsors and senior management stakeholders
Create change management strategy and action plans in coordination with the project manager and the executive sponsor aligned with each project or initiative
Identify, analyze, prepare, and implement risk mitigation tactics and plans
Identify and manage anticipated change resistance within and across organizations
Consult and coach project teams using the tools, processes, and outputs of the ADKAR methodology
Create actionable deliverables for the five change management levers: (1) communications plan, (2) sponsor roadmap, (3) coaching plan, (4) training plan, (5) resistance management plan
Directly support communication efforts. Depending on the project, this may include creation of communication content and management of deliverables; as well as, the overall ownership of the communication plan
Support and coordinate training efforts as needed
Support and engage senior leaders as required to ensure the success of the project(s)
Support organizational design and definition of new roles and new responsibilities with respect to the future state created by the change initiative
Coordinate efforts with other specialists or stakeholders, both internal or external to the university, to ensure successful change outcomes
Integrate change management activities into project plans in coordination with project managers
Evaluate and ensure user readiness prior to and during change implementation
Manage stakeholders and stakeholder expectations in coordination with executive sponsors
Proactively track and report issues (risk & risk mitigation) during the project
Define and measure success metrics for the project; and, monitor and report change progress
Support change management at the organizational level, as defined in the WGU Enterprise Change Management Plan
Manage the project portfolio and change management load (change saturation risk) in partnership with management during the annual operations planning and strategic planning cycles
